Have we reached the OM617/616 tipping point?

I went out to the junk yard this morning to do some reconnaissance on various potential parts in anticipation of a half price sale coming up next weekend. There were no MB diesels in the yard. This is the first time this has ever occured. Historically there have been 6-12 617/616s available. There were lots and lots of MB gassers of various types but no diesels.

I'm thinking that instead of considering the junk yards as a ready source of parts to be sourced as needed, it may be time to start being opportunistic and grabbing stuff as available and keeping them in stock for the future use.

Have we reached a tipping point?
